Uttam Nagar has narrow lanes, older buildings without lifts, and a mix of 1RK, 1BHK, and 2-3BHK homes packed close together. A mover who's used to wide Gurgaon sectors or Dwarka's planned roads will struggle here — and that struggle usually gets passed on to you as extra labour charges or delays. Local experience isn't a marketing line in Uttam Nagar. It genuinely changes how smooth your move is.
Pricing depends on the size of your home, the floor you're on (and whether there's a lift), the distance, and whether you need packing material or just labour and transport. Here's a rough range based on what we typically quote for local moves within Delhi NCR:
| Move Type | Typical Price Range (Local) | What's Usually Included |
| 1 RK / 1 BHK | ₹4,000 – ₹7,000 | Packing, loading, transport, unloading |
| 2 BHK | ₹7,000 – ₹12,000 | Packing, loading, transport, unloading |
| 3 BHK | ₹12,000 – ₹18,000 | Full packing, disassembly of large furniture, transport |
| Office (small, <15 seats) | ₹10,000 – ₹20,000 | Workstation dismantling, IT equipment handling, transport |
| Car / Bike Transport | ₹3,500 – ₹8,000 | Loading on carrier, insurance option, delivery |
These are starting ranges, not fixed quotes — an upper-floor flat without a lift on a narrow Uttam Nagar gali will cost more than a ground-floor unit on a main road, and that's normal. What shouldn't be normal is a mover quoting you ₹5,000 on the phone and then asking for ₹9,000 once your fridge is already on the truck. Ask for the full breakdown in writing before you confirm anything.
